Rabindranath Tagore’s contribution to Bengali literature and music is unforgettable. He was the first non-European to win a Nobel prize in literature and a celebrated poet & writer all over the world. The Tagore’s ancestral residence AKA the Jorasanko Thakur Bari has been restored as a museum and this is why you need to go here!

“The Butterflies Counts Not Months But Moments” | Jorasanko Thakur Bari was built-in the 18th century and is the place where Rabindranath Tagore spent most of his childhood. The house has been restored in such a way that it depicts how the household looked when the Tagore family lived there and displays details of the family’s history. 

Several cultural programmes like Panchise Baisakh, Baishe Shravan and Aban Mela are also organised here. Jorasanko Thakur Bari is a must-visit place for an enriching experience!

Where | Jorasanko Thakur Bari - Ganesh Talkies, 267, Rabindra Sarani, Singhi Bagan, Jorasanko
Timings | 10:30 AM - 5 PM
Entry | Rs 5 Onwards
